Nitish Katara Murder Case Convict Vikas Yadav Seeks Bail To Get Married
Vikas Yadav sought interim bail on the ground that his marriage was fixed for September 5 and he had to arrange the fine amount of Rs 54 lakh which was imposed on him at the time of sentencing.
